We are a fast-moving team who is responsible for using evidence-based analytics to assess existing strategies, evaluate risks and opportunities, recommend revised or new strategies, evaluate competing business priorities, and provide recommendations on strategic direction to Weyerhaeuser’s Corporate Development Leadership team. In this role, you will provide analytical support for the company’s best-in-class portfolio analytics technology platform that leverages earth observation data together with geo-spatial biological and physical data, business data, and market information to develop strategic planning tools and recommendations. The successful candidate must have experience compiling, cleaning, sampling and testing large data sets. This role will be part of the Portfolio Analytics team and will be based in Seattle, WA. Geospatial Data Analyst Responsibilities • Support data science efforts in a fast-paced team environment to accelerate our efforts of building out our analytics driven product pipeline. • Support the data scientist(s) by sourcing, compiling, and integrating different data sources to ensure consistency and compatibility for analysis, while also handling data cleaning, preprocessing, sampling, and conducting testing and validation using statistical analysis methods, particularly Python. • Assist the data scientist(s) in the design and execution of algorithms for domain-specific tasks . • Assist in the development or customization of tools, scripts, or software to automate and optimize data processing and analysis tasks. • Translate existing tools and workflows into reusable Python scripts. • Build cross-functional relationships to collaboratively partner within our business, data science team and IT. • Proactively identify ways to improve data reliability, efficiency, and quality. • Support the development of communicative and impactful reports on model inputs, model outputs, business impact and key performance indicators. • Document processes, methodologies, and findings to ensure reproducibility and clarity for other team members. • Support large geospatial dataset collection, including QA/QC and format standardization. • Follow standard Weyerhaeuser best practices in managing geospatial data and source code. • Support the development and presentation of compelling, validated stories to all levels of our organization, including peers, senior management, and internal customers, that communicate the value of earth observation (EO) analytics to drive strategic business initiatives. This role typically requires a minimum of 3-4 years of prior experience working with large geo-temporal data sets, including EO imagery (Landsat, Sentinel, aerial photos). Education: You have a bachelor’s degree or higher in a related field with a quantitative emphasis such as Computer Science, Statistics, Resource Economics, Business, Biology, Geospatial data science, or Forestry.Master’s degree preferred. Skills: To be successful in this role, you understand machine learning concepts and possess strong communication skills with the ability to excite business leaders on the utility of these analytic tools for strategic business decision making.You are a passionate and creative problem solver and are coachable and committed to expanding knowledge and skills. Technical Requirements: We need an individual who has a strong working knowledge inMicrosoft office products (Excel, PowerPoint, Power BI), as well as proficiency in programming environment and languages, specifically Python and R.You’ll need knowledge of analytic and visualization packages available for those languages. You’ll need GIS skills (e.g., ArcGIS). You’ll also need experience with data structures such as Numpy, Pandas and Geopandas, and familiarity utilizing open-source Python analytic libraries such as: SciKit Learn, SciPy. You’ll need cloud computing experience, preferably in the AWS environment. Highly Valued • Forest industry operational experience • Proficiency in multiple statistical and data management packages • Exposure to Xarray data structure, parallelization tools Dask. • Exposure to machine learning and deep learning frameworks like TensorFlow, PyTorch, or Keras • Experience with relational and non-relational databases
